Ampang
Neighborhood Overview
Ampang is one of the most affordable and authentic neighborhoods in Kuala Lumpur for expats. Located east of the city along the Ampang River, this historic area has preserved its authentic charm with traditional houses and the famous Korea Town.
The area is especially popular with expats working in finance and oil and gas, thanks to its proximity to the city centre and attractive prices. For commuting, the AKLEH highway and Ampang LRT line connect you easily to the rest of the city. Check our transport guide.

Lifestyle
Pros
- +Best value for money among KL expat neighbourhoods — larger homes, lower rent, and lower cost of daily living
- +International School of Kuala Lumpur (ISKL) located within the neighbourhood, making school runs easy
- +Exceptional Korean dining and grocery shopping — the best Koreatown in KL with truly authentic options
- +Space and land — landed properties with large gardens at affordable prices, rare in KL's expat market
- +Diverse and authentic community offering a genuine Malaysian living experience rather than a curated expat bubble
Cons
- −More variable safety across different parts of the neighbourhood compared to gated communities like Desa ParkCity
- −Less polished and curated environment — the area can feel scruffy and unkempt in some parts
- −Limited European/Western dining and cafe scene compared to Bangsar or Mont Kiara
- −Traffic congestion on Jalan Ampang and Jalan Tun Razak can be very heavy during peak hours
- −The neighbourhood's sprawl makes walking impractical for most daily errands — a car is essential
